YEAHBUZZY is a queer-owned Atlanta apparel brand that sells from a stall inside Citizen Supply, the local-maker marketplace on the second floor of Ponce City Market. The line runs to bold graphic tees, tanks, jockstraps, headwear, and stickers, all designed in Atlanta and produced in small US batches rather than ordered wholesale off a catalog. The brand is a certified LGBT Business Enterprise through the NGLCC and ties its retail to a Live Bold initiative that channels support to local nonprofits, often through community events. Because it lives inside Citizen Supply, a stop here folds neatly into a wander through Ponce City Market, where you're browsing one queer label among more than a hundred independent makers under one roof.
